Modern ophthalmic surgery relies heavily on advanced vitrectomy surgical tools to perform delicate procedures with precision. These instruments, often made of medical-grade polymers, are designed to limit patient trauma and optimize outcomes. From micro-scissors to illuminators, the selection of available tools allows surgeons to effectively address a variety of retinal pathologies. Continuous advancements in technology lead to finer instruments, enhancing surgical dexterity and patient recovery.

Vitrectomy Recovery Aids for Optimal Healing

Post-vitrectomy, proper recovery is paramount. While your ophthalmologist will provide specific instructions, incorporating certain aids can significantly improve your healing journey. A comfortable eye shield helps prevent accidental injury during the initial days of recovery. Refraining from strenuous activity is crucial, allowing your eyes to heal. A soothing eye solution can combat dryness, while warm compresses applied to the operated eye can reduce inflammation. Follow your surgeon's guidance diligently, and remember that patience is key during this healing process.
